name
-
(Roman)The deity of shepherds, flocks and livestock in Roman mythology.
“Near-synonym: Pan (Greek counterpart, not identical)”
- 49 Pales, a main belt asteroid.
Definitions from Wiktionary, CC BY-SA.
Etymology
From Latin Palēs, from Etruscan.
